Description
Tumor Necrosis Factor-Alpha (TNF alpha) is a protein secreted by lipopolysaccharide-stimulated macrophages, and causes tumor necrosis when injected into tumor-bearing mice. TNF alpha is believed to mediate pathogenic shock and tissue injury associated with endotoxemia. TNF alpha exists as a multimer of two, three, or five noncovalently linked units, but shows a single ∽17kDa band following SDS-PAGE under non-reducing conditions.
TNF alpha Monoclonal antibody specifically detects TNF alpha in Human samples. It is validated for Flow Cytometry.Specifications
